I live on the Tibetan plateau and I am trying to find a localy-sold, ecologicaly sound, yet hopefuly insulating and cheap flooring to put in my home. My ecologicaly-sound choices seem to be bamboo or tile with rugs on top. A tile floor would be cheaper, but, if bamboo has insulating qualities, I might want to go with that. Do any of you know if bamboo, like wood, tends to have some insulating properties?

It is my understanind that bamboo has some insulative qualities but like wood, they are not enormous.  Furthermore, often bamboo flooring is very thin and thus would have less insulative quality than a thicker peice of wood of say, maple.  If your heat distribution warms the floor I would go with tile because it retains heat better than wood.
